The Finnic Phonetics Symposium (Fonetiikan päivät / Foneetika päevad) in an annual conference, where various phonetics-related topics are discussed – such as, for example, spoken language and voice research, speech therapy, and speech technology. The Symposium is held in Finland and Estonia but is usually joined by the participants from other European countries.
This year, the scientific program includes both presentations and posters and a technical workshop. Besides researchers, educators and students, field experts, for example, from clinical and forensic sciences, and speech technology companies, are expected at the symposium. Working languages are Finnish and English.
